Israeli airstrikes in Jabalia refugee camp: 13 dead, 20+ injured, many trapped

By | May 26, 2024

In a breaking news development, a residential complex in Jabalia refugee camp, northern Gaza, has been struck by Israeli airstrikes, leaving a devastating aftermath. The rubble of the complex now reveals the grim reality: 13 Palestinians have lost their lives, more than 20 others are injured, and several individuals remain trapped beneath the debris.
